"One of the most popular aquariums in the country, the Shedd houses more than 32,500 creatures from around the world." Full review
"Encased in a handsome marble octagon overlooking the Lake, the Shedd is the world's largest indoor aquarium."
"Anchoring the aquatic offerings at this 75-year-old institution are enduring favorites such as piranhas, frogs and snakes of the Amazon." Full review
"Marine and freshwater creatures from around the world are on view in this 1929 Classical Greek-inspired Beaux Arts structure."
3 Stars
"The world's largest indoor aquarium. It houses some 8,000 aquatic animals comprising 650 species from around the globe." Full review

"At this urban enclave near Lake Michigan, you can face off with lions (separated by a window, of course) outside the Kovler Lion House." Full review
"Although it's charmingly small, you should still allow yourself two to three hours to wander the paths among landmark Georgian Revival brick buildings and colorful flower gardens."
"See some 1,200 animals, from apes to zebras, at the oldest and one of only a few free zoos left in the country." Full review
"One of the city's treasures, this family-friendly attraction is not only open every day of the year, but it's also free." Full review
"Oldest free zoo in the U.S."
"With more than 1,250 animals, Lincoln Park Zoo ranks as one of the finest in the country." Full review
